Oklahoma City receives approximately 36 inches of rainfall annually, but the distribution and intensity of that precipitation is what makes gutter maintenance a critical priority for commercial property managers across the metro area. The city sits squarely in the heart of Tornado Alley, producing some of the most unpredictable and violent severe weather patterns of any major American city — including powerful supercell thunderstorms from March through June that can deliver hail, high winds, and several inches of rain in a matter of hours, a summer storm season that produces intense downpours with very little warning, and a fall season defined by significant debris accumulation from Oklahoma City's expanding urban tree canopy of post oak, eastern red cedar, and cottonwood trees. In Oklahoma City's rapidly expanding urban and suburban landscape, gutters accumulate post oak leaves, cottonwood seeds, eastern red cedar debris, and the red clay sediment that Oklahoma City's distinctive soil composition generates during heavy rainfall events — all compounding into blockages that high-volume thunderstorm rainfall cannot flush clear on its own.

For property managers overseeing garden-style apartment communities, HOA-governed master-planned developments, and large multifamily housing portfolios across neighborhoods from Bricktown and Edmond to Moore, Yukon, and Midwest City, clogged gutters during an Oklahoma City supercell or hail event are a direct path to foundation damage, fascia deterioration, and interior water intrusion across multiple buildings simultaneously. Ken's Gutters recommends professional gutter cleaning at minimum three times per year for most Oklahoma City commercial properties — with critical service windows in late spring before peak severe weather season, midsummer, and late fall after debris accumulation concludes.

Commercial gutter cleaning pricing varies based on the specifics of each property, which is why we always provide a custom quote. Our minimum is $1,500 per job and we typically charge per linear foot of gutter, with rates generally ranging from $1.00 to $2.00 per linear foot depending on the property. Final pricing depends on several factors including total linear footage, building height and number of stories, access and terrain complexity, roof pitch, gutter type and debris level, accessibility of downspouts, and any specialized equipment required such as lifts or scaffolding.
